WEB SERVICE

Use as intruções a baixo para que você consiga integrar a sua aplicação ao nosso webService.


Integração SMS API


Requisitos

Parâmetro Descrição Tipo Obrigatório
token Seu token de identificação. string Sim
phone Número do destinatário, apenas números, com DDD, Não deve conter nenhum tipo de simbolo. Exemplo: 11988887777. numeric Sim
msg Sua mensagem, deve ter no máximo 160 caracteres, aceita letras, numeros e sinais. Não deve conter nenhum tipo de acento e nem quebra de linha. string Sim

URL para requisições GET

GET http://webservice.scriptmundo.com/smsapi/send
Exemplo de requisição PHP
$msg   = str_replace(' ','%20',"Teste de mensagem Testando API");
$phone = "45999437955";
$token = "SEU TOKEN";
$url   = "http://webservice.scriptmundo.com/smsapi/send?token=".$token."&phone=".$phone."&msg=".$msg;

$response = file_get_contents($url);
print_r($response);


									
Exemplo de requisição PHPcURL

$msg   = str_replace(' ','%20',"Teste de mensagem Testando API");
$phone = "45999437955";
$token = "SEU TOKEN"
$url   = "http://webservice.scriptmundo.com/smsapi/send?token=".$token."&phone=".$phone."&msg=".$msg;

$init = curl_init($url);
curl_setopt( $init , CURLOPT_RETURNTRANSFER  , true );
$response = curl_exec($init);
curl_close($init);
print_r($response); 

									
Resposta jSon
									    {
 "cod":200,
 "acesso":"permitido",
 "msg":"Mensagem Enviada",
 "date":{
   "hora":"02:20",
   "data":"21-03-2019"
   }
 }
									

Respostas COD

cod Descrição Representa
406 Erro ao enviar, verifique os dados fornecidos. Erro
405 Necessário usar um Token. Erro
404 Nenhum parâmentro foi passado. Erro
403 O conteúdo da mensagem é necessário. Erro
402 O número de telefone é necessário. Erro
401 Saldo insuficiente. Erro
400 O Token informado é inválido. Erro
200 Requisição bem sucedida. Sucesso